Early Life and Family
Eva Lys was born on January 12, 2002, in Kyiv, Ukraine. At the tender age of two, her family relocated to Hamburg, Germany, in search of better opportunities. This shift laid the foundation for Eva’s future as a tennis prodigy. Her father, Vladimir Lys, played a pivotal role in shaping her career. A former professional tennis player who represented Ukraine in the Davis Cup, Vladimir now serves as her coach. Her mother, Maria, is a lawyer, bringing a balance of discipline and encouragement to the family dynamics.
Family ties to tennis run deep for Eva. Her older sister, Lisa Matviyenko, is also a professional tennis player, while her younger sister, Isabella, represents the next generation. The family’s shared bond over tennis created an atmosphere that nurtured Eva’s potential.
Education and Early Interests
Eva attended the prestigious Sportgymnasium Alter Teichweg in Hamburg, a school known for producing top-tier athletes. Eva excelled not only in sports but also academically, successfully completing Germany’s rigorous high school Abitur program. Her favorite subject was biology, which she found fascinating alongside her training routine. She became part of the German Tennis Federation and the Porsche Talent Team, receiving mentorship from former WTA player Barbara Rittner.
Eva’s introduction to tennis came early, at around five years old, spurred by her father’s profession as a coach. She spent countless hours on the courts, playing while her mother pursued further education in Germany. It was clear from the beginning that Eva had the grit and the skills to shine in the sport.
Career Achievements and Highlights
Eva Lys officially stepped onto the professional tennis stage in 2016, making her debut on the ITF Circuit. Her hard work paid off when she won her first ITF singles title in Altenkirchen, Germany, in 2020. Over the years, she accumulated three ITF Women’s Circuit titles and carved her name in the tennis scene.
Breakthrough Moments
Eva’s breakthrough on the WTA Tour came in 2022 at the Stuttgart Open, where she reached the second round as a qualifier, defeating Viktorija Golubic. A notable moment came in 2023, when she made her Grand Slam main-draw debut at the Australian Open. She eventually notched her first-ever Grand Slam victory at the 2023 US Open with an impressive win over Robin Montgomery.
The year 2024 saw Eva reach new heights with several quarterfinal and semifinal appearances, including at the Budapest Grand Prix, Jasmin Open, and Transylvania Open. Her consistent performances helped her achieve a career-high singles ranking of No. 105 by September 2024.
2025 and Latest News
At the 2025 Australian Open, Eva achieved a major milestone. Entering the main draw as a lucky loser, she made history by reaching the fourth round, becoming the first lucky loser to do so in the Open Era. Her tenacity earned her recognition within the tennis world, even as she faced a rout against World No. 2 Iga Świątek in her historic run.

Personal Challenges and Triumphs
Eva Lys’s world has not been without struggles. Born in Kyiv, she and her family have faced emotional difficulties since the Russian invasion of Ukraine. Reflecting on the ongoing conflict, Eva has spoken out about the disrespectful behavior of some players in the tennis community. This courage to voice her beliefs demonstrates her strong character.
On the court, Eva’s career hasn’t been without setbacks. From injuries to tough losses, including a retirement due to illness in the 2024 Jasmin Open semifinal, she has faced her share of hurdles.
